About Pikeville Medical Center 

Administration | Board of Directors

Pikeville Medical Center is the region's leader in the health care industry. During the past 85 years, PMC has grown into a 261-bed facility with a growing campus featuring a 555,000 square feet structure.

PMC employs over 1700 people and over 200 physicians practice here. With a progressive, supportive administration and board of directors, our employees and physicians have the tools and training they need to provide excellent quality health care. Technology, innovation, vision and finance are rapidly driving Pikeville Medical Center towards its goal of being a National Leader in Health Care

Pikeville Medical Center is home to some of the most sophisticated, technologically advanced medical equipment to be found anywhere.

State-Of-The-Art Diagnostic Equipment
PMC has invested millions to offer the most advanced diagnostic imaging equipment available anywhere. Our radiologists have access to two Siemens SOMATOM 64 slice CT scanners, and we now have the new GE Discover HD 75 CT scanner that offers unprecedented image quality.

PMC was the second hospital in the world to purchase the Fonar(tm) Open Stand-up MRI. This MRI can scan patients in a much more comfortable, less stressful environment than ever available before.

Our diagnostic imaging is now even more advanced with the addition of the 1.5 T Espree Open MRI and we are in the process of installing a 3.0 T Verio Open MRI!

In addition, the PACS system now allows physicians to have access to many of their patients' diagnostic images within seconds after they are scanned, whether the physician is in Pikeville, or on the other side of the globe.

Top quality Cancer Care

Pikeville Medical Center recently invested more than $10 million to purchase two RapidArc™ linear accelerators to treat cancer patients. One unit is already in use, and the other will be operational in April. Our cancer center routinely wins the prestigious Commission on Cancer award.

Neurosurgery
PMC's new BrainLab system allows our neurosurgeons, Dr. Duane Densler and Dr. Norman Mayer, to track the fibers and neural pathways to plan their journey into and out of the brain. This leads to surgeries that are more accurate, more effective, safer and with less damage to surrounding brain tissue.



The Heart Institute
Pikeville Medical Center introduced Open Heart Surgery to our region in 2002. Since then, over 675 open heart procedures have been performed by world class cardiothoracic surgeons like Dr. Dennis Havens (above right). In addition, Dr. Bill Harris (above, left), one of the worlds finest, and most respected, interventional cardiologists, moved his well established practice from Lexington to Pikeville for the multitude of benefits that Pikeville Medical Center offered him as a physician.

4-D Echocardiograms
Pikeville Medical Center was the first hospital in Kentucky to offer the exceptional imaging delivered by the GE Vivid Dimension 7 "4-D" echocardiogram system. With this system, our cardiologists can virtually see inside the chambers of your heart, watch it beat, and observe the movement from almost any angle imaginable.

Digital Mammography
PMC has invested in the Selenia Digital Mammography system that allows radiologists far better imaging than previously available. This leads to earlier detection, more accurate diagnoses, and more lives saved.
